Transaction 80e276a3bf45945e08f395e29fea003dbd1048db0c31443bab9b312ff2839efa
1 Input
2 Outputs
- 80e276a3bf45945e08f395e29fea003dbd1048db0c31443bab9b312ff2839efa:0
- 80e276a3bf45945e08f395e29fea003dbd1048db0c31443bab9b312ff2839efa:1
value 3960169972
address 1PBcB6Qcd29SYFtygAaXS1C9pLoMAxmSEh
value 1000000
address 1DvwXzCzr1Qofs663kmQk4uCKo8WD5szgr